> > > Hello everyone,
> > >
> > > We just ran out of space for the Airflow documentation build and our
> > > documentation stopped being published - with the last provider's
> > > releases.
> > >
> > > The process of building requires all versions of Airflow to be present
> > > when publishing new documentation.
> > >
> > > As a stop-gap measure - I have prepared pr with removed docs for
> > > <1.10.15 https://github.com/apache/airflow-site/pull/740. The old docs
> > > are kept in git history and we can revert this change back asap. I
> > > think not having information about < 1.10.14 is much better than not
> > > having information about the latest providers (and airflow when we
> > > release it soon).
> > >
> > > Unless someone has a better idea (and PR), I see that as the fastest
> > > way to temporarily fix the problem and I am going to merge it soon
> > > unless we have some objection and counter-proposal.
> > >
> > > However this is going to come back soon. I believe Ash mentioned that
> > > someone from Astronomer **might** be able to help with rewriting the
> > > docs build process so I think this is about the last moment to do so,
> > > because if we continue, releasing new versions of both providers and
> > > airflow without any change, the problem is going to get worse.
> > >
> > > Next stop-gap measure is to remove docs for old providers' versions.
